如意工具箱
介绍
linux下精良的命令行工具很多,但要记得那么多命令和参数实在是很困难,前段时间我将自己的系统换成了ubuntu便决心做一个能够整合命令行工具的小程序,为一些命令行工具提供界面以方便使用,到目前为止该工具基本已满足个人日常使用,软件部分运行截图如下:
使用说明
1.添加系统中已有的程序或应用,可以通过如意工具箱快捷启动。
2.现有工具说明
- 以管理员运行 -> 以root用户运行指定的程序或命令
- 便捷 -> 方便日常临时信息记录
- 屏幕共享 -> 共享屏幕或应用程序窗口,局域网内的其他用户可以通过浏览器访问。
- 快捷方式 -> 为指定的程序或命令创建快捷启动文件。
- 软件安装 -> 安装deb或rpm包应用程序
- 密码管理 -> 管理日常使用的账户密码,一键复制密码。防止摄像头和身后偷窥。
- 文件编码 -> 做编码转换,解决linux下在window打包文件乱码问题。
- WIFI热点 -> 创建wifi热点供其他设备连接。(未实现)
- PDM查看器 -> 查看power designer生成的模型文件。
- 修改图片尺寸 -> 批量修改图片尺寸大小。
- 端口映射 -> 基于SSH映射远程端口到本地或本地端口到远程,建立访问隧道。
- ISO文件挂载 -> 挂载ISO镜像文件。
- 查看VDI -> 挂载虚拟机磁盘镜像文件。
- maven依赖 -> 查看依赖树;拷贝依赖到指定文件夹。
- 问题修复 -> 检查系统问题并提供修复方案或自动修复。(未实现)
- weblogic管理 -> 创建域,启动指定域weblogic容器。
软件架构
nodejs+nw.js+命令行工具
使用说明
1.因为最初制作本工具是为满足个人使用,我使用的是ubuntu16.4,项目内的部分工具依赖本地环境,暂时未做兼容,请使用时注意。
开发指南
- 克隆项目代码
- 安装node环境(已安装则跳过)
- 进入项目目录运行npm install (推荐使用淘宝镜像)
- 运行 npm start 启动项目
交流
可扫描下方群二维码,加群交流